The energy supply chain is a complex and intertwined network of entities responsible for bringing energy from its source to consumers. Effectively navigating this chain requires familiarity with the roles and responsibilities of each participant.
- Extractors are responsible for obtaining energy from natural resources such as oil, gas, coal, or renewable sources like solar and wind.
- Refining companies take raw materials and convert them into usable forms of energy.
- Shippers play a crucial role in moving energy products across water using pipelines, tankers, or rail networks.
- Wholesalers purchase energy from producers and suppliers, then distribute it to consumers.
Cooperation between these key roles is essential for a efficient energy supply chain that meets the demands of a growing global population.
Energy Market Intermediaries
The energy market is a complex and dynamic system, with numerous players acquiring power and trading it across various sectors. Within this intricate web lies the role of energy brokers, dedicated in streamlining transactions between buyers and sellers. Serving as intermediaries, they leverage their in-depth market knowledge to secure optimal deals for clients. Energy brokers navigate the complexities of pricing fluctuations, contract terms, and regulatory requirements, providing valuable insights and support throughout the procurement process.
Their expertise extends to identifying matching energy sources, analyzing market trends, and optimizing client portfolios for effectiveness. Ultimately, energy brokers play a role to a more fluid and transparent energy market, serving energy procurement and supply roles both buyers and sellers.
Facilitators: Connecting Suppliers and Consumers in the Energy Landscape
In the intricate web of the energy industry, distributors play a vital role. They serve as the crucial connection between energy suppliers and end consumers, ensuring a smooth and consistent flow of power to homes, businesses, and industries. Distributors procure energy from various sources, distribute it through their established infrastructures, and control its allocation based on consumer demand.
- Additionally, distributors often engage in auxiliary services such as energy conservation programs, customer assistance, and billing administration.
- Consequently, distributors impact significantly to the integrity of the energy landscape by ensuring a seamless flow of energy resources.
